This 161.4 acre tract in Tripp County offers an excellent opportunity for ranchers, cattlemen, and outdoor enthusiasts alike. Designed for efficient use, the property is fully cross-fenced for rotational grazing, making it ideal for maximizing forage and livestock management. A well on the property provides a reliable water source, ensuring consistent access for cattle.
Beyond its ranching potential, this land also delivers strong recreational appeal. The diverse habitat, rolling terrain, and mature tree cover create prime conditions for whitetail deer and other wildlife. Shelterbelts not only protect livestock from the elements but also offer natural cover that holds game throughout the year.
